Account Executive Business Locations: Charlottetown, PE, Canada; Northampton, MA, USA Preferred Candidate Location: Atlantic Canada Work Arrangement: Hybrid / Remote-Friendly About Discovery Garden Discovery Garden helps libraries, archives, museums, and special collections gain control of their digital collections. From historic photographs at public libraries to unique archival collections at universities and museums, we help institutions manage, organize, and provide access to the materials that matter most. For more than 15 years, our team has worked alongside librarians, archivists, metadata specialists, and collection managers to solve the challenges of managing digital collections. Today, our team brings together more than 100 years of combined experience in libraries, archives, digital collections, and repository technologies. Our purpose is to make it easier to manage and share the world’s digital collections. Role Overview We’re looking for an Account Executive to grow Discovery Garden’s presence within libraries, archives, and higher education institutions in the United States. This is a full-cycle role responsible for generating new business opportunities, managing sales cycles, and guiding institutions through conversations about digital collections, repository modernization, migration, and accessibility. Working closely with our Chief Revenue Officer, you’ll identify prospective clients, build relationships with key stakeholders, lead discovery and product demonstrations, respond to RFP’s and procurement processes, and guide opportunities through to signed agreements. In collaboration with our BDR’s, Marketing, and Operations team, you’ll be responsible for developing your pipeline through outreach, conferences, networking, webinars, industry engagement, while consistently advancing opportunities. Our purpose is to make it easier for organizations to manage and share their digital collections. You’ll help prospective clients understand how Discovery Garden’s solutions can support their goals related to digital collections management. While experience working with libraries, archives, museums, or higher education institutions is considered a strong asset, we are equally interested in candidates with a proven ability to build relationships, generate opportunities, and navigate complex sales processes. The ideal candidate is curious, consultative, self-motivated, and excited to learn a specialized industry while helping organizations solve meaningful challenges. Preferred Qualifications Experience in sales, business development, account management, consulting, or a related field. Strong communication and relationship-building skills. Ability to learn new technologies and industry concepts quickly. Comfortable working with both technical and non-technical stakeholders. Self-motivated, organized, and able to work independently and collaboratively. Experience with outreach, presentations, webinars, conferences, or client engagement is an asset. Familiarity with digital collections, repositories, preservation systems, or library technologies is an asset. Experience working with libraries, archives, museums, or higher education institutions is highly valued. What You’ll Do Generate new business opportunities through email, phone, social media, conferences, and professional networking. Build relationships with prospective clients across libraries, archives, museums, and higher education institutions. Lead discovery meetings to understand client goals, challenges, and requirements. Conduct product demonstrations and guide prospects through the evaluation process. Prepare and respond to proposals, RFPs, RFQs, and RFIs. Identify opportunities where Discovery Garden’s solutions can deliver value. Represent Discovery Garden at conferences, webinars, and industry events. Collaborate with technical and leadership teams to support sales opportunities. Maintain accurate pipeline and activity tracking in HubSpot CRM. Stay informed about trends in digital collections, repositories, preservation, and related technologies. Why Join Discovery Garden? Work with institutions preserving and sharing globally important cultural and academic content. Join a highly specialized team (38% MLIS/Deep GLAM Experience, 48% GLAM Software Developers) with deep expertise in digital repositories. Help shape the future of repository modernization and digital access strategies. Collaborate directly with leadership on growth, positioning, and industry engagement. Flexible work environment with opportunities for conference travel and professional development. Competitive salary plus performance-based incentives. Application Process Please submit your resume along with a short cover letter explaining: Why are you interested in this role? What experience you would bring to the position. Why do you think you’d be successful helping Discovery Garden grow? We welcome candidates from all backgrounds and are committed to building an inclusive and supportive workplace.
